#8E651F Color
#8E651F is rgb(142, 101, 31) in RGB, hsl(38, 64%, 34%) in HSL, and about cmyk(0%, 29%, 78%, 44%) in CMYK. It has no registered color name of its own — the closest is Golden Brown (#996515), clearly related but distinguishable side by side at ΔE 7.43. White text is the more readable choice on this background.

#8E651F Channel Values
How #8E651F breaks down in each color model. Hue is measured in degrees around the color wheel; saturation, lightness, and the CMYK inks are percentages.
| Model | Channels | Notes |
|---|---|---|
| RGB | R 142 · G 101 · B 31 | 8-bit channels as sent to the display |
| HSL | H 38° · S 64% · L 34% | Easiest model for building lighter and darker variants |
| HSV | H 38° · S 78% · V 56% | Matches the picker in most design tools |
| CMYK | C 0% · M 29% · Y 78% · K 44% | Approximate ink mix; confirm with an ICC profile before printing |
| Luminance | 5.21:1 vs white · 4.03:1 vs black | WCAG 2.2 relative-luminance contrast ratios |
Text Contrast & Accessibility
WCAG 2.2 contrast ratios for text on a #8E651F background. AA requires 4.5:1 for normal text and 3:1 for large text; AAA requires 7:1. Contrast is one check, not a full accessibility review.

#8E651F Frequently Asked Questions
What color is #8E651F?
#8E651F is a dark brown — rgb(142, 101, 31) in RGB and hsl(38, 64%, 34%) in HSL. It carries no registered color name of its own; the closest named color is Golden Brown (#996515), which is clearly related but distinguishable side by side at a CIE76 distance of 7.43.
What is the RGB value of #8E651F?
#8E651F is rgb(142, 101, 31) — red 142, green 101, and blue 31 on the 0-255 scale.
What is the CMYK value of #8E651F?
#8E651F converts to approximately cmyk(0%, 29%, 78%, 44%). CMYK output is a mathematical approximation for planning; confirm production print colors with your printer and ICC profile.
Should text on #8E651F be black or white?
White text is the more readable choice. #8E651F scores 5.21:1 against white and 4.03:1 against black, and WCAG 2.2 asks for at least 4.5:1 for normal body text.
Can I write #8E651F as a CSS color keyword?
No. #8E651F is not one of the CSS color keywords, so it has to be written as a hex, rgb() or hsl() value. The closest keyword is saddlebrown (#8B4513) at a CIE76 distance of 18.07, which is visibly different.
